Isaiah 22:4-6
Darby Translation
4 Therefore said I, Look away from me; let me weep bitterly: labour not to comfort me, because of the spoiling of the daughter of my people.
5 For it is a day of trouble, and of treading down, and of perplexity, from the Lord, Jehovah of hosts, in the valley of vision; [a day of] breaking down the wall, and of crying to the mountain:
6 —Elam beareth the quiver with chariots of men [and] horsemen; and Kir uncovereth the shield.
